Restaurant De Haan

Restaurant De Haan in Groningen presents a distinctive culinary experience where three master chefs orchestrate a modern French narrative within a high-signal surprise menu. The identity is built on technical precision and ingredient reverence, manifest in the signature slow-cooked beef cheek. This preparation achieves a yielding, tender consistency and is paired with sweet yellow carrot and crisp shiitake tempura, releasing a profound savory depth. Technical authority is also shown in the vegetarian Stroganoff, intensified by a sophisticated reduction of Madeira and port. The menu features stir-fried Brussels sprouts with aged bacon and silky white chocolate ice cream with pickled grapes. Techniques such as innovative fermentation and precise emulsification for house sabayons ensure a complex interplay of flavors.
